There … WebFeb 23, 2024 · In the 19 th century, surgeons pioneered the use of hypnosis and researchers began to investigate the technique. Surgeons like James Esdaile and John Elliotson were able to find that the use of hypnosis could relieve the pain associated with surgery, and this led to hypnosis being used as a clinical technique in some hospitals. crowne plaza nec birmingham parking

Hypnosis is as old as humanity, its roots existed in the ancient ages. One of the oldest medical papers, the Ebers Papyrus, written 1550BC, gives a description about a technique that involves eye fixation then suggestions while the eyes are shut (Stefan 2015) as an aid for treating pain and doing surgeries (Meares 2009). building facilitiesWebNov 26, 2024 · Hypnotherapy has a long and illustrious history, with its practice tracing back to the very start of recorded history.
